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> Flash Приложения: AIR, Zinc и тд.

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 31.10.2007, 03:07
mehas вне форума Посмотреть профиль Отправить личное сообщение для mehas Найти все сообщения от mehas
  № 1  
Ответить с цитированием
mehas

Регистрация: Jul 2007
Сообщений: 7
А как быть если мне не желательно юзать всякие там browseFor*??

Можно ли просто тихо мирно сохранить файл?
Удалить? Без всяческих окон.

Просто у меня в таком случае (при прописывании путей ручками) вылетает ошибка.. нету доступа.

Помогите решить проблемку.

З.Ы. Никаких системных файлов я не трогаю, только файлы в папке с программой.

Старый 31.10.2007, 07:59
screamge вне форума Посмотреть профиль Отправить личное сообщение для screamge Посетить домашнюю страницу screamge Найти все сообщения от screamge
  № 2  
Ответить с цитированием
screamge
Ветеран форума
 
Аватар для screamge

Регистрация: Jul 2006
Адрес: Грузия, Тбилиси
Сообщений: 2,675
Ошибка скорее всего вылетает из-за того что вы пытаетесь прочесть несуществующий файл, нужно проверять на существование таким образом:
Код:
if (file.exists){
При записи проблем возникать не должно так как при отсутствии файл создаётся, если конечно вы не обладаете правами администратора.

Записывать файлы на машине конечного пользователя есть нехорошая практика, а так конечно возможно. И удаление тоже.

Код:
var stream:FileStream = new FileStream ();		
	
var docs:File = File.applicationResourceDirectory;
var path:String = docs.nativePath; //ссылка на директорию в которой установлено приложение
				

var file:File = new File (path + '/some1.txt');
stream.open (file, FileMode.WRITE);
stream.writeUTFBytes('hallo');
stream.close();	

file.deleteFile();
__________________
Free-lance | Twitter | Me

Старый 31.10.2007, 10:23
etc вне форума Посмотреть профиль Найти все сообщения от etc
  № 3  
Ответить с цитированием
etc
Et cetera
 
Аватар для etc

Регистрация: Sep 2002
Сообщений: 30,784
Цитата:
Сообщение от screamge
Записывать файлы на машине конечного пользователя есть нехорошая практика, а так конечно возможно. И удаление тоже.
Речь скорее всего про запись конфигов всяких.

Старый 31.10.2007, 10:56
screamge вне форума Посмотреть профиль Отправить личное сообщение для screamge Посетить домашнюю страницу screamge Найти все сообщения от screamge
  № 4  
Ответить с цитированием
screamge
Ветеран форума
 
Аватар для screamge

Регистрация: Jul 2006
Адрес: Грузия, Тбилиси
Сообщений: 2,675
Не знаю что можно в конфигах инстал папки записывать кроме того что не настраивается во флеше. resizible, minimazible и т.д. имею в виду.
__________________
Free-lance | Twitter | Me

Старый 31.10.2007, 13:16
etc вне форума Посмотреть профиль Найти все сообщения от etc
  № 5  
Ответить с цитированием
etc
Et cetera
 
Аватар для etc

Регистрация: Sep 2002
Сообщений: 30,784
Настройки программы
Не в SharedObject же складывать.

Старый 31.10.2007, 13:18
screamge вне форума Посмотреть профиль Отправить личное сообщение для screamge Посетить домашнюю страницу screamge Найти все сообщения от screamge
  № 6  
Ответить с цитированием
screamge
Ветеран форума
 
Аватар для screamge

Регистрация: Jul 2006
Адрес: Грузия, Тбилиси
Сообщений: 2,675
А это да
__________________
Free-lance | Twitter | Me

Старый 01.11.2007, 10:21
alexcon314 вне форума Посмотреть профиль Отправить личное сообщение для alexcon314 Найти все сообщения от alexcon314
  № 7  
Ответить с цитированием
alexcon314
listener

модератор форума
Регистрация: Jun 2006
Сообщений: 3,260
Записей в блоге: 28
Отправить сообщение для alexcon314 с помощью ICQ
шаредобжект для хранения настроек вполне подходит. и хранится он в профиле, значит у каждого автоматом свои настройки будут. работать с ним из флэша легко. правда вручную править плохо но на то есть редактор solEdit.

Создать новую тему Ответ Часовой пояс GMT +4, время: 01:55.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 01:55.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.